Why This Book?

Stop-motion animation has been a passion and calling of mine for 30 years. My undergraduate studies were in Design at the Rochester Institute of Technology (where I now teach), and animation came into my life quite by accident. In my last two years at RIT, a new teacher, Erik Timmerman, decided to start an animation course, the first at RIT. Having been raised on cartoons with a love from Rocky and Bullwinkle to Gumby, I felt compelled to take this course. Upon my graduation, two years later, I was on my way to Hollywood to collect a Student Academy Award along with my partner Malcolm Spaull for our stop-motion version of Lewis Carroll’s The Walrus and the Carpenter.
